I initially put this on private settings hence the date but thought it set the scene so aptly for my journey and so wanted to share........

Well it was a good sign when my airport transfer driver said he had lived in Duai for 10 years. We talked Dubai for 30 minutes which is all it took from 3.15 in the morning. I was nervous at check-in because despite all of the hype I was on an ID 90,great price but not guaranteed.

The smile and nod at check in was such a relief that I thought I was invincible- exempt from anything untoward from this moment on. I was wrong.

When customs opened I felt a confidence and freedom I hadn't felt in years. When others were scoffing down their drinks and ditching items in the bins, I barely heard the drone of voices warning about declaring liquids and dangerous goods - not me.

When I heard the "madam could you step aside please" I thought I was in a Border Security script, yes that's how it goes down but hey, me? When the guard said they would have to search my bag I still thought it must be a random check- trust me!

After all the contents were displayed unlovingly over the bench the culprits revealed themselves- BLONDE HAIR COLOUR !!! You don't have to be a science teacher to know the contents are a CLASSIC no no. OMG I could smell the Border Security cameras....

After a shaky start I bought some Chanel No. 5 - in the hope this random impulse buy would restore the bliss I was feeling before my blonde ambition.
